nico nopi show and JWT

I went to the nopi nico show in chandler AZ last weekend. I was disappointed because the hype was much greater than the show. I did meet some of the nico guys on sat but it rained all day sunday. There were some really nice tricked out cars and because of nico there were a ton of nissan and ifinitis from mild to wild.
I did go to JWT and they retuned the car. With the supercharger boosting at 11.2 lbs we dynoed 341.2 at the wheels using their dynapack RHAS-SP V1.0 unit. They couldn't do N20 because I couldn't lock the 3200 torque conv and this dyno must see steady torque at the hubs. When they tried, their dyno shut down due to tq slippage but clark said if the torque is hi enough to shut down the dyno it's putting out serious power because only a few automatics have done this . and he estimated at least 425 fwhp with N20.

I almost forgot to mention Jim took me for a ride in his 350Z convertible with his recently developed twin turbo unit. He is waiting for CARB certification but he put one on his ride. All I can say is I was buried in the seat when he took off. The car made tremendous torque and it dynos 361 RWHP. I highly recommend this turbo!!
